// Heads-up, reviewer: this constant sets the idempotency-key TTL
// for payment retries in the Bramblepay gateway. Keys shorter-lived
// than the retry window caused double charges back in the Welch
// incident, so keep this comfortably above max backoff. Yes, 48h
// feels generous — that's deliberate. The build where we last tuned
// this is stamped right below.

build token for kagaf-hahof: htk14_9d3d4d26d7d8de

## Deployment

Sproutline is the plant-watering scheduler running in the Hallowmere greenhouse cluster. Deploys go out via the standard pipeline; the scheduler drains active watering jobs before restarting, which takes up to ten minutes. If a deploy stalls, check that no zone is mid-cycle. On-call should never kill the process during a drain — valves can stick open. After deploy, verify the service picked up the expected settings. The configuration it should be running with is as follows.

config for kagup-hahig:
druwyn:
  pin: 2801
  metrics_host: metrics.druwyn.zemvarlabs.internal
  tenant: sorius
  seal: seal_798a43d7

Handover: Gatehouse rate limiting

Hey Priya — handing you the Gatehouse gateway work. The new token-bucket limiter is merged but behind a flag; per-route overrides still need review (see my open PR). Watch the burst handling on the batch routes, it's touchy. Everything you need to reproduce my test setup is in this config block:

deployment values, kajep-kageg:
[praix]
host = praix.paliqcorp.corp
user = praix_svc
database = praix_prod